Chris James Hewitt is a freelance Designer & Art Director currently based in London. Working under his Dstrukt guise Chris has produced work for a mix of high-end clients scattered over the globe including MTV Networks Europe, Vodafone BBC, Digitalvision, & Dr Martens.
Featured in numerous industry publications and presenting at various design conferences in the UK Chris has received critical acclaim in both online and traditional media.

ThinkingParticles 2.5 Released

Cebas releases Thinking Particles 2.5, the latest free upgrade for cebas’ ThinkingParticles.
The new 2.5 release shows why ThinkingParticles is the world’s most powerful rule based particle system for 3ds max. cebas continues to listen to users and make improvements available – at no charge to users – to an already robust product. ThinkingParticles 2.5 gives users unprecedented value for 3ds max and VIZ.
